here this one works cuz i used it,
CODE <marquee><img src="LINK" alt="Image hosted by Photobucket.com"><img src="LINK" alt="Image hosted by Photobucket.com"><img src="LINK" alt="Image hosted by Photobucket.com"><img src="LINK" alt="Image hosted by Photobucket.com"><img src="LINK"><img src="LINK"><img src="LINK"></marquee> make sure to replace the link with your link |
